[Details →](./docs/AI_INTELLIGENCE.md#browser-side-ml-pipeline) ### Scoring Algorithms **Country Instability Index** — 0–100 score from baseline risk (40%), unrest (20%), security (20%), and information velocity (20%), with conflict-zone floors and travel advisory boosts. [Details →](./docs/ALGORITHMS.md#country-instability-index-cii) **Hotspot Escalation** — blends news (35%), CII (25%), geo-convergence (25%), and military (15%) with 48-hour trend regression. [Details →](./docs/ALGORITHMS.md#hotspot-escalation-scoring) **Strategic Theater Posture** — 9 operational theaters assessed for NORMAL → ELEVATED → CRITICAL based on aircraft, strike capability, naval presence, and regional CII. [Details →](./docs/ALGORITHMS.md#strategic-theater-posture-assessment) **Geographic Convergence** — 1°×1° spatial binning detects 3+ event types co-occurring within 24 hours. [Details →](./docs/ALGORITHMS.md#geographic-convergence-detection) **Trending Keywords** — 2-hour rolling window vs 7-day baseline flags surging terms with CVE/APT extraction. [Details →](./docs/ALGORITHMS.md#trending-keyword-spike-detection) ### Data Collection **435+ RSS feeds** with 4-tier source credibility, server-side aggregation, and per-feed circuit breakers. Runtime variant selector in the header bar. --- ## Programmatic API Access Every data endpoint is accessible programmatically via `api.worldmonitor.app`. The API uses the same edge functions that power the dashboard, with the same caching and rate limiting: ```bash # Fetch market quotes curl -s 'https://api.worldmonitor.app/api/market/v1/list-market-quotes?symbols=AAPL,MSFT,GOOGL' # Get airport delays curl -s 'https://api.worldmonitor.app/api/aviation/v1/list-airport-delays' # Fetch climate anomalies curl -s 'https://api.worldmonitor.app/api/climate/v1/list-climate-anomalies' # Get earthquake data curl -s 'https://api.worldmonitor.app/api/seismology/v1/list-earthquakes' # Company enrichment (GitHub, SEC filings, HN mentions) curl -s 'https://api.worldmonitor.app/api/enrichment/company?domain=stripe.com' # Company signal discovery (funding, hiring, exec changes) curl -s 'https://api.worldmonitor.app/api/enrichment/signals?company=Stripe&domain=stripe.com' ``` All 22 service domains are available as REST endpoints following the pattern `POST /api/{domain}/v1/{rpc-name}`. GET requests with query parameters are supported for read-only RPCs. Responses include `X-Cache` headers (`HIT`, `REDIS-HIT`, `MISS`) for cache debugging and `Cache-Control` headers for CDN integration. > **Note**: Use `api.worldmonitor.app`, not `worldmonitor.app` — the main domain requires browser origin headers and returns 403 for programmatic access. --- ## Security Model | Layer | Mechanism | | ------------------------------ | -------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------- | | **CORS origin allowlist** | Only `worldmonitor.app`, `tech.worldmonitor.app`, `finance.worldmonitor.app`, and `localhost:*` can call API endpoints. All others receive 403. Implemented in `api/_cors.js`. | | **RSS domain allowlist** | The RSS proxy only fetches from explicitly listed domains (~90+). Requests for unlisted domains are rejected with 403. | | **Railway domain allowlist** | The Railway relay has a separate, smaller domain allowlist for feeds that need the alternate origin. | | **API key isolation** | All API keys live server-side in Vercel environment variables. The browser never sees Groq, OpenRouter, ACLED, Finnhub, or other credentials. | | **Input sanitization** | User-facing content passes through `escapeHtml()` (prevents XSS) and `sanitizeUrl()` (blocks `javascript:` and `data:` URIs). URLs use `escapeAttr()` for attribute context encoding. | | **Query parameter validation** | API endpoints validate input formats (e.g., stablecoin coin IDs must match `[a-z0-9-]+`, bounding box params are numeric). | | **IP rate limiting** | AI endpoints use Upstash Redis-backed rate limiting to prevent abuse of Groq/OpenRouter quotas. | | **Desktop sidecar auth** | The local API sidecar requires a per-session `Bearer` token generated at launch. The token is stored in Rust state and injected into the sidecar environment — only the Tauri frontend can retrieve it via IPC. Health check endpoints are exempt. | | **OS keychain storage** | Desktop API keys are stored in the operating system's credential manager (macOS Keychain, Windows Credential Manager), never in plaintext files or environment variables on disk. | | **SSRF protection** | Two-phase URL validation: protocol allowlist, private IP rejection, DNS rebinding detection, and TOCTOU-safe address pinning. | | **IPC window hardening** | All sensitive Tauri IPC commands gate on `require_trusted_window()` with a `TRUSTED_WINDOWS` allowlist. | | **Bot protection middleware** | Edge Middleware blocks crawlers from `/api/*` routes. Social preview bots are selectively allowed on `/api/story` and `/api/og-story`. | --- ## Regression Testing The test suite includes **30 test files** with **554 individual test cases** across **147 describe blocks**, covering server handlers, caching behavior, data integrity, and map overlays. **Unit & integration tests** (`npm test`) validate: | Area | Test Files | Coverage | | --- | --- | --- | | **Server handlers** | `server-handlers`, `supply-chain-handlers`, `supply-chain-v2` | All 22 proto service handler imports, route registration, response schemas | | **Caching** | `redis-caching`, `route-cache-tier`, `flush-stale-refreshes` | Cache key construction, TTL tiers, stale refresh coalescing, stampede prevention | | **Data integrity** | `bootstrap`, `deploy-config`, `edge-functions` | Bootstrap key sync between `cache-keys.ts` and `bootstrap.js`, all 57 edge function self-containment (no `../server/` imports), version sync across package.json/tauri.conf.json/Cargo.toml | | **Intelligence** | `military-classification`, `clustering`, `insights-loader`, `summarize-reasoning` | Military confidence scoring, news clustering algorithms, AI brief generation, LLM reasoning chain parsing | | **Map & geo** | `countries-geojson`, `globe-2d-3d-parity`, `map-locale`, `geo-keyword-matching` | GeoJSON polygon validity, flat/globe layer parity, locale-aware map labels, 217-hub keyword matching | | **Protocols** | `oref-proxy`, `oref-locations`, `oref-breaking`, `live-news-hls` | OREF alert parsing, 1480 Hebrew→English location translations, HLS stream detection | | **Circuit breakers** | `hapi-gdelt-circuit-breakers`, `tech-readiness-circuit-breakers`, `smart-poll-loop` | Per-source failure isolation, adaptive backoff, hidden-tab throttling | | **Data sources** | `gulf-fdi-data`, `ttl-acled-ais-guards`, `urlState` | Gulf FDI coordinate validation, ACLED/AIS TTL guards, URL state encoding/decoding | **E2E map tests** use Playwright with the map harness (`/tests/map-harness.html`) for overlay behavior validation. --- ## Quick Start ```bash # Clone and run git clone https://github.com/koala73/worldmonitor.git cd worldmonitor npm install vercel dev # Runs frontend + all 60+ API edge functions ``` Open [http://localhost:3000](http://localhost:3000) > **Note**: `vercel dev` requires the [Vercel CLI](https://vercel.com/docs/cli) (`npm i -g vercel`). Key groups: | Group | Variables | Free Tier | | ----------------- | -------------------------------------------------------------------------- | ------------------------------------------ | | **AI (Local)** | `OLLAMA_API_URL`, `OLLAMA_MODEL` | Free (runs on your hardware) | | **AI (Cloud)** | `GROQ_API_KEY`, `OPENROUTER_API_KEY` | 14,400 req/day (Groq), 50/day (OpenRouter) | | **Cache** | `UPSTASH_REDIS_REST_URL`, `UPSTASH_REDIS_REST_TOKEN` | 10K commands/day | | **Markets** | `FINNHUB_API_KEY`, `FRED_API_KEY`, `EIA_API_KEY` | All free tier | | **Tracking** | `WINGBITS_API_KEY`, `AISSTREAM_API_KEY` | Free | | **Geopolitical** | `ACLED_ACCESS_TOKEN`, `CLOUDFLARE_API_TOKEN`, `NASA_FIRMS_API_KEY` | Free for researchers | | **Relay** | `WS_RELAY_URL`, `VITE_WS_RELAY_URL`, `OPENSKY_CLIENT_ID/SECRET` | Self-hosted | | **UI** | `VITE_VARIANT`, `VITE_MAP_INTERACTION_MODE` (`flat` or `3d`, default `3d`) | N/A | | **Observability** | `VITE_SENTRY_DSN` (optional, empty disables reporting) | N/A | See [`.env.example`](./.env.example) for the complete list with registration links. --- ## Self-Hosting World Monitor relies on **60+ Vercel Edge Functions** in the `api/` directory for RSS proxying, data caching, and API key isolation. Running `npm run dev` alone starts only the Vite frontend — the edge functions won't execute, and most panels (news feeds, markets, AI summaries) will be empty. ### Option 1: Deploy to Vercel (Recommended) The simplest path — Vercel runs the edge functions natively on their free tier: ```bash npm install -g vercel vercel # Follow prompts to link/create project ``` Add your API keys in the Vercel dashboard under **Settings → Environment Variables**, then visit your deployment URL. The free Hobby plan supports all 60+ edge functions. ### Option 2: Local Development with Vercel CLI To run everything locally (frontend + edge functions): ```bash npm install -g vercel cp .env.example .env.local # Add your API keys vercel dev # Starts on http://localhost:3000 ``` > **Important**: Use `vercel dev` instead of `npm run dev`. The Vercel CLI emulates the edge runtime locally so all `api/` endpoints work. Plain `npm run dev` only starts Vite and the API layer won't be available. ### Option 3: Static Frontend Only If you only want the map and client-side features (no news feeds, no AI, no market data): ```bash npm run dev # Vite dev server on http://localhost:5173 ``` This runs the frontend without the API layer. Panels that require server-side proxying will show "No data available". The interactive map, static data layers (bases, cables, pipelines), and browser-side ML models still work. ### Platform Notes | Platform | Status | Notes | | ---------------------- | ----------------------- | ------------------------------------------------------------------------------------------------------------------------------ | | **Vercel** | Full support | Recommended deployment target | | **Linux x86_64** | Full support | Works with `vercel dev` for local development. Desktop .AppImage available for x86_64. WebKitGTK rendering uses DMA-BUF with fallback to SHM for GPU compatibility. Font stack includes DejaVu Sans Mono and Liberation Mono for consistent rendering across distros | | **macOS** | Works with `vercel dev` | Full local development | | **Raspberry Pi / ARM** | Partial | `vercel dev` edge runtime emulation may not work on ARM. Use Option 1 (deploy to Vercel) or Option 3 (static frontend) instead | | **Docker** | Official image | See [Docker image](#docker-image-official) ([#1260](https://github.com/koala73/worldmonitor/issues/1260)) | ### Docker image (official) An official Docker image is published to GitHub Container Registry on each [release](https://github.com/koala73/worldmonitor/releases) ([#1260](https://github.com/koala73/worldmonitor/issues/1260)): - **Image**: `ghcr.io/koala73/worldmonitor` - **Architectures**: `linux/amd64`, `linux/arm64` - **Tags**: `latest`, `vX.Y.Z` (e.g. `v2.6.0`), and `X.Y` (e.g. `2.6`) The image is **frontend-only**: it serves the Vite-built static app with nginx and proxies `/api/*` to an upstream API. No Node or edge functions run inside the container. **Build (from repo root):** ```bash docker build -f docker/Dockerfile -t ghcr.io/koala73/worldmonitor:latest . ``` **Run (default API: `https://api.worldmonitor.app`):** ```bash docker run -d --name worldmonitor -p 3000:80 ghcr.io/koala73/worldmonitor:latest ``` Then open [http://localhost:3000](http://localhost:3000). **Environment variables:** | Variable | Default | Description | | --------------- | ------------------------------ | ------------------------------------------------ | | `API_UPSTREAM` | `https://api.worldmonitor.app` | Backend URL for `/api/*` proxy (set at runtime) | The proxy forwards the upstream host (`Host: `) so the default API receives the correct Host. If your backend expects a different Host, configure it accordingly. Example with a custom API backend: ```bash docker run -d -p 3000:80 -e API_UPSTREAM=http://my-api:3001 ghcr.io/koala73/worldmonitor:latest ``` Build-time options (optional, for custom builds): pass `VITE_VARIANT` and `VITE_WS_API_URL` via `--build-arg`. Other `VITE_*` vars the app uses (e.g. `VITE_PMTILES_URL`, `VITE_WS_RELAY_URL`) can be added the same way; see `.env.example` for the full list. ### Railway Relay (Optional) The Railway relay is a multi-protocol gateway that handles data sources requiring persistent connections, residential proxying, or upstream APIs that block Vercel's edge runtime: ```bash # On Railway, deploy with: node scripts/ais-relay.cjs ``` | Service | Protocol | Purpose | | ----------------------- | --------------- | -------------------------------------------------------------------- | | **AIS Vessel Tracking** | WebSocket | Live AIS maritime data with chokepoint detection and density grids | | **OpenSky Aircraft** | REST (polling) | Military flight tracking across merged query regions | | **Telegram OSINT** | MTProto (GramJS)| 26 OSINT channels polled on 60s cycle with FLOOD_WAIT handling | | **OREF Rocket Alerts** | curl + proxy | Israel Home Front Command sirens via residential proxy (Akamai WAF) | | **Polymarket Proxy** | HTTPS | JA3 fingerprint bypass with request queuing and cache deduplication | | **ICAO NOTAM** | REST | Airport/airspace closure detection for 46 MENA airports | Set `WS_RELAY_URL` (server-side, HTTPS) and `VITE_WS_RELAY_URL` (client-side, WSS) in your environment. Without the relay, AIS, OpenSky, Telegram, and OREF layers won't show live data, but all other features work normally. --- ## Tech Stack | Category | Technologies | | --------------------- | ---------------------------------------------------------------------------------------------------------------------------------------------- | | **Frontend** | Vanilla TypeScript (no framework), Vite, globe.gl + Three.js (3D globe), deck.gl + MapLibre GL (flat map), vite-plugin-pwa (service worker + manifest) | | **Desktop** | Tauri 2 (Rust) with Node.js sidecar, OS keychain integration (keyring crate), native TLS (reqwest) | | **AI/ML** | Ollama / LM Studio (local, OpenAI-compatible), Groq (Llama 3.1 8B), OpenRouter (fallback), Transformers.js (browser-side T5, NER, embeddings), IndexedDB vector store (5K headline RAG) | | **Caching** | Redis (Upstash) — 3-tier cache with in-memory + Redis + upstream, cross-user AI deduplication.
